00 — Overview
Why this repo exists
devops-infra-helm-charts is the GitOps source-of-truth for what infrastructure tooling runs on Meesho's GKE fleet, where, and with what values. It is one of two repos that together compose the platform's deploy plane:
- This repo — values + cached/forked charts. Answers "what does cluster X's Argo CD agent stack look like?"
- Sister repo —
Meesho/devops-infra-argo-config— ArgoApplication/ApplicationSetmanifests. Answers "which cluster pulls which path from the values repo, with what sync policy?"
A merge to main here is a deploy event: every Argo CD instance whose Application points at a touched path will reconcile, on its own cadence (auto-sync) or on a human Sync click (manual-sync — the prod default).

How a change reaches a cluster
- Branch off
main. - Edit a single
helm-overrides/<cluster>/<app>/custom-values.yaml. - Local dry-run:
helm template <release> helm-templates/<chart> -f helm-overrides/<cluster>/<app>/custom-values.yaml. - Commit — TruffleHog runs (blocking). Never
--no-verify. - Open a PR. Reviewer is the first safety gate.
- Merge to
main. - Argo CD on the target cluster either auto-reconciles (low-risk leaves) or waits for a human Sync click (prod infra default).
That click is the second safety gate. The combined property (reviewer + Sync) is the system's safety floor while a tool-mediated edit path (helm-values-tool) is still being built.
